Brennan Vineyards
Comanche, TX
Brennan Vineyards was founded in 2001 by Dr. Pat and Trellise Brennan. Their love of wine has brought us where we are today. Brennan Vineyards is located at one of the oldest remaining homesteads in Texas with our tasting room in the Historic McCrary House. The Historic McCrary House, located on the property of Brennan Vineyards, was built in 1879 by ‘Mat’ McCrary, who volunteered with the Minute Men Rangers. Dedicated to making wines from 100% Texas fruit, Brennan Vineyards was the first Texas winery to receive two double gold awards in 2015 at the prestigious San Francisco International Wine Competition for its 2014 Mourvédre Dry Rosé and 2013 Tempranillo.
Bull Lion Ranch Vineyard & Winery
Hico and Glen Rose, TX
The Bull Lion Ranch, located near Chalk Mountain Texas. was established in 1989 by the Tordiglione family. The ranch gets its name from the Italian definition of Tordiglione, which means “Bull of the Lion”. Today they are still an operating ranch that runs primarily registered red angus and performance paint horses, and now they grow grapes and make fine wine.

Red Caboose Winery
Clifton & Meridian, TX
Red Caboose Winery is an award winning, ecologically friendly, family owned Texas business. Red Caboose Winery produces award-winning Texas wines and spirits from estate-grown grapes. Grapes are grown using sustainable methods naturally, by hand, yielding superior quality fruit. This enables us to craft “Old World” wines using long-established methods.
The name comes from the red caboose Gary McKibben purchased and brought to the property. The McKibben family has been growing sustainable wines the natural way since 2003. Today, the winery hosts a slew of events, from live music, the popular Cork and Fork series in each summer month, and even the fun-and-messy-for-all Grape Stomp.
The winery proudly produces big red wines like Tempranillo, Syrah, Tannat, Touriga Nacional, Zinfandel, and Black Spanish, also known as Lenoir. The wines continue to win awards and medals in statewide, national, and international competitions
